Solution for 2x+43=5x+13 equation:


Simplifying
2x + 43 = 5x + 13

Reorder the terms:
43 + 2x = 5x + 13

Reorder the terms:
43 + 2x = 13 + 5x

Solving
43 + 2x = 13 + 5x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-5x' to each side of the equation.
43 + 2x + -5x = 13 + 5x + -5x

Combine like terms: 2x + -5x = -3x
43 + -3x = 13 + 5x + -5x

Combine like terms: 5x + -5x = 0
43 + -3x = 13 + 0
43 + -3x = 13

Add '-43' to each side of the equation.
43 + -43 + -3x = 13 + -43

Combine like terms: 43 + -43 = 0
0 + -3x = 13 + -43
-3x = 13 + -43

Combine like terms: 13 + -43 = -30
-3x = -30

Divide each side by '-3'.
x = 10

Simplifying
x = 10
